FWP Commission met today<br />

The <strong>Montana</strong> Fish, Wildlife & Parks Commission met<br />

today in Helena. Among the agenda items to be discussed was<br />

the South <strong>Glasgow</strong> Conservation Easement (CE) Proposal.<br />

The <strong>Montana</strong> Glaciated Plains Milk River Conservation<br />

and Restoration State Wildlife Grant was approved in<br />

December 2006. It's objective is to "place 10,000 acres within<br />

the Milk River Riparian Zone under conservation easements,<br />

or other appropriate strategies, to conserve fish and wildlife<br />

communities including game and nongame species." This<br />

effort, called The Milk River Initiative, meshes perfectly<br />

with the habitat objectives of the Upland Game Bird Habitat<br />

Enhancement Program.<br />

The 324-acre South <strong>Glasgow</strong> Project is located 1 mile<br />

south of <strong>Glasgow</strong> along the Milk River in Valley County.<br />

The property is managed for grain production. One parcel<br />

extends along 0.3 miles of the Milk River and the other parcel<br />

includes 2 oxbows approximately 0.75 miles in length. The<br />

mix of fields and riparian cover, and the adjacent Milk River,<br />

makes this ranch important to white-tailed deer, pheasants,<br />

waterfowl, fish, two threatenedlendangered Species, six<br />

<strong>Montana</strong> species of concern.<br />

Standardconservation easement covenants would protect<br />

native habitats along the Milk River and the two oxbows.<br />

Extensive habitat enhancements would be implemented to<br />

expand riparian zones and increase cover throughout the<br />

grain fields, primarily for pheasants. Habitat enhancements<br />

would represent UGHEP projects that are not held for a<br />

short term as done with standard UGHEP projects, but in<br />

perpetuity. Acquisition of a CE will guarantee free public<br />

access to this ranch and to the Milk River for hunting, fishing<br />

and other types of public recreation. The Brazil Creek and<br />

Lower Brazil Creek CEs are located along the Milk River 3<br />

miles west of the South <strong>Glasgow</strong> CE Project.<br />

The South <strong>Glasgow</strong> Project CE proposal has not yet<br />

been subjected to public comment. If the FWP Commission<br />

endorses this action an environmental assessment,<br />

management plan and socioeconomic analysis will be<br />

prepared and made available to the public for a 21-day<br />

comment period. In addition, a public hearing will be held<br />

in <strong>Glasgow</strong>.<br />

Proposed Action: FWP to purchase, hold, enhance and<br />

-<br />

monitor a South Glasnow Proiect CE.<br />

No Action Alternative: The ranch could be sold to<br />

a recreational buyer with no guaranteed preservation of<br />

existing agricultural values, wildlife habitat or public access,<br />

or the opportunity for habitat enhancement.<br />

Agency Recommendation & Rationale: FWP<br />

recommends approval by the FWP Commission to proceed<br />

with purchasing a South G1asgow Project CE using FWP's<br />

UGBEP funds in conjunction with SWG funds.<br />

Proposed Motion - Support FWP's recommendation to<br />

purchase a conservation easement on this property.<br />
